I played in my first Adventurers League game on Fantasy Grounds last night as a player. It was part of the Virtual Gary Con going on this weekend. First off it was a great time. The DM was excellent and the party worked really well with each other and were engaged in voice on Discord. We did a lot of theater of the mind utilizing Fantasy Grounds for dice rolls and a couple of tactical maps.

The adventure was DDAL09-01 Escape From Elturgard. I played as a level 1 Dwarf Cleric named Krogan Warbrew utilizing the Forge Domain from Xanathars Guide to Everything. I believe it was a 5 part module that we were able to complete right at the 4 hour mark.

The highlight of Krogann’s adventure was on the final encounter. The party was investigating a murder in the middle of the night. Krogan, who had been woken from a deep slumber, was walking around the camp with his warhammer, shield, and nothing on but his small clothes. Upon discovering the perpetrator, and walking around almost naked for an hour, Krogan had had enough. He dropped his shield to wield his warhammer in 2 hands, channeled Searing Smite into his holy weapon, and utilized his inspiration to critical hit the final boss pumping in 25 points of damage. It was the kind of dice roll every player dreams of! Upon smiting his foe Krogan stood over his vanquished enemy raising his warhammer in salute to the god Moradin and started gyrating wildly in exultation, waving his banana hammock in all its glory.
